Church of the Holy Spirit

Location

Church of the Holy Spirit at Margao is positioned in the town square in the old market area. The revered place is also known as Largo De Igreja and was constructed by Jesuit missionaries in 1564.

In series of historic events, the church was destroyed in 1571 and was erected again in 1645. Church attractions are the richly decorated altars dedicated to Immaculate Conception of Mary. Consecrated in 1675, the church has pristine white façade of Indian Baroque artwork.

The interiors are ripe with gilt, crystal and stucco. The church stands at a place where a Hindu temple dedicated to Lord Damodar stood in 1585 and was destroyed by the Portuguese.
